Key Facts
- Guilt by Disassociation's instance of is recorded as television series episode[2].
- Guilt by Disassociation was directed by John Pasquin[3].
- Guilt by Disassociation followed The Little Sister[4].
- Guilt by Disassociation was followed by Somebody Stole My Gal[5].
- Guilt by Disassociation's part of the series is recorded as Roseanne[6].
- The original language of Guilt by Disassociation was English[7].
- Guilt by Disassociation's original broadcaster is recorded as American Broadcasting Company[8].
- Guilt by Disassociation's country of origin is recorded as United States[9].
- Guilt by Disassociation was published on September 26, 1989[10].
